The fully revised, restructured and updated second edition of the ICE Manual of Bridge Engineering has been written and edited by a team of leading experts and presents valuable contributions from across the field within a single resource. The second edition comprehensively addresses key topic within bridge engineering, from history and aesthetics to design, construction and maintenance issues.
Chapter 1 : The History and Aesthetic Development of Bridges Chapter 2 : Bearings Chapter 3 : Loads and Load Distribution Chapter 4 : Bridge Dynamics Chapter 5 : Seismic Response and Design Chapter 6 : Substructures Chapter 7 : Inspection and Assessment Chapter 8 : Design of Reinforced Concrete Bridges Chapter 9 : Design of Prestressed Concrete Bridges Chapter 10 : Design of Steel Bridges Chapter 11 : Composite Construction Chapter 12 : Design of Arch Bridges Chapter 13 : Repair, Strengthening and Replacement Chapter 14 : Aluminium In Bridges Chapter 15 : Cable Stayed Bridges Chapter 16 : Suspension Bridges Chapter 17 : Movable Bridges Chapter 18 : Footbridges Chapter 19 : Advanced Fibre Polymer Composite Materials and Their Properties For Bridge Engineering Chapter 20 : Advanced Fibre Polymer Composite Structural Systems Used in Bridge Engineering Chapter 21 : Bridge Accessories Chapter 22 : Protection Chapter 23 : Bridge Management Chapter 24 : Deterioration, Investigation, Monitoring and Assessment
